Our History

From a modest community group to a state-level development organization, Sristy has consistently stood by the poor and marginalized, working for equity, dignity, and justice.

1997

Sristy for Human Society founded as a grassroots initiative in Rajarhat.

2000

Officially registered under the Societies Registration Act.

2002 – 2005

Partnered with Ministry of Health & Family Welfare for RCH programs.

2004

Registered under Foreign Contribution Regulation Act (FCRA).

2005 – 2007

Expanded programs to Malda, Murshidabad, Hooghly, focusing on HIV/AIDS, women’s rights, and industrial labor outreach.

2007 – 2013

Collaborated with UNICEF, ActionAid, IGSSS, DFID, CASA, and others to scale up health, education, and livelihood initiatives.

2014 – Present

Focused on anti-trafficking, child rights, and women empowerment across multiple districts.

2020 – 2021

Responded to humanitarian crises with COVID-19 and Aamphan relief efforts in partnership with CASA, Azim Premji Foundation, ActionAid, and others.
